Key Takeaways
- Prioritize units with a triplex pump if you plan to clean surfaces for several hours every week.
- Match your PSI rating to the project because using too much force on soft wood or car paint will cause damage.
- Check that the hose length provides enough reach to finish your driveway without needing an extension cord or constant repositioning.
- Confirm the machine is 49-state compliant if you live in California, as this affects the engine models available to you.
- Look for induction motors if you prefer a quieter machine that requires less maintenance than a traditional gas engine.

Frequently Asked Questions
Should I be home during the cleaning process?
You do not necessarily need to be present if the crew has access to your water spigot and the work area is unlocked. However, being home is helpful if you need to move vehicles or secure pets. Most companies prefer you stay inside to avoid any safety hazards from high-pressure spray.
Can pressure washing damage my siding?
Yes, improper technique can easily damage wood, vinyl, or stucco. Professionals use a soft wash approach for fragile areas, which relies on cleaning solutions rather than raw force. This keeps your home exterior intact while still removing mold and mildew.
How often should I have my house pressure washed?
Most experts recommend a professional cleaning once a year to prevent the buildup of grime and organic growth. If you live in a humid area, you might notice algae returning sooner. Regular maintenance is a small price to pay to extend the life of your paint and exterior materials.
Is it safe for my plants and landscaping?
A quality provider will pre-soak your plants with fresh water before and after applying any cleaning detergents. This dilutes any chemicals that might drift onto your foliage. Make sure they use biodegradable solutions to keep your garden healthy and vibrant.
What is the difference between pressure washing and power washing?
People often use these terms interchangeably, but power washing typically involves the use of heated water. The heat helps break down grease and oil stains on driveways much faster than cold water alone. Pressure washing generally refers to using high-pressure water at ambient temperatures for standard dirt removal.
